Someone once said, "When the legend becomes fact, print the legend." J.M Dupont (author) and Mezzo (illustrator) have done just that by creating a gorgeous and entertaining graphic novel capturing Delta bluesman Robert Johnson's short life and long legend. Wine, whiskey and song... plus a little place you might know as The Crossroads. They're all in there. Essential for any lover of blues or art! - Roger Stolle, Cat Head

 

From the web: Exploring the stories and legends that surround his life and death — his childhood, his womanizing, his pact with the devil at the crossroads — Mezzo and DuPont have produced a fittingly creative and beautiful depiction of this most extraordinary life.
